Subject: Quickstore 4.2 — bloom filter now fronts the KV layer

Plugin authors: starting with this release, Quickstore places a bloom filter ahead of the key-value store. Negative lookups return faster; false positives fall through safely. No API changes are required on your side. Verify your plugin against the staging build referenced below.

session token of fahif-tadup = htk3_9c7

## Ticket: Staging quotas misconfigured (Rookmere)

Per-tenant rate quotas in Rookmere staging were reading the production limits table, letting one tenant consume the shared pool. Fix is to point QUOTA_SOURCE at the staging table and redeploy the limiter. For the sync: the limiter also needs its datastore credential restored in the env file, which goes on the following line.

vault entry, kagep-yajeg: COURIER_KEY5=da097

Subject: Cron-to-Windmere cut-over summary

Hello plugin authors — as of this morning, all scheduled jobs on the Larkspur platform have been migrated from host-level cron to the Windmere workflow engine. Legacy crontabs have been disabled but preserved for thirty days. Plugins registering scheduled tasks must now declare them via the Windmere manifest; direct cron registration will be rejected. The engine settings your plugins will run under are the following.

settings of kahag-bagug:
[quenath]
port = 6379
region = outer-2
host = quenath.nelvrocorp.internal
timeout_ms = 2000
retries = 3